CakePHP in Japan

Friday, July 24th, 2009

Cakephp Bakers are increasing rapidly in Japan. I think there are some reasons as follow.

1. Books

There are over 7  japanese books for CakePHP!  Japanese Book is very important factor to get many developers in Japan.

Some books for beginner(XAMP install, bake, create small applications), some books for intermediate or higher level( component, behavior, helper, test cases, mobile site, Routing, callbacks, create practical applications).

2. Community Site

Japanese cakephp community ( http://cakephp.jp ).  There is a good forum on its web site. Many bakers ask questions and argue many topics in japanese , very usefull for not only beginners but also higher level users. Sometimes find some bugs in that discussion, then post tickets for trac.cakephp.org.

3. Events

Now in japan,  it is boom of meet-up for study( Programming, Design, Server Operation, etc ). In these meet-up, many different company people come together after working or in a holiday, and discuss some topics, often talking with drinking beer :-)

There were some CakePHP meet-up in  Tokyo, Osaka and Fukuoka. This is a report of CakePHP meet-up at Tokyo. http://bakery.cakephp.org/articles/view/report-cakephp-meet-up-at-tokyo-4th

In these meet-up, 50 or 100 japanese bakers come together, so nice events.

4. Blogs

There are many japanese baker’s blogs. Some bakers post good articles ( how to solve a problem, find bug, explain or make compoent, behavior, plugins,etc). If we have problems, we can find japanese articles of that resolutions  easily with the google.

It is very important to get many japanese information and resolutions easily.
